Infinite-modal approximate solutions of the Bryan-Pidduck equation
Journal Title: Математичні Студії - Year 2018, Vol 49, Issue 1
Abstract
Abstract The nonlinear integro-differential Bryan-Pidduck equation for a model of rough spheres is considered. An approximate solution is constructed in the form of an infinite linear combination of some Maxwellian modes with coefficient functions that depend on time and spatial coordinate. Sufficient conditions for the infinitesimality of the uniformly-integral error between the parts of the Bryan-Pidduck equation are obtained.
